Kerli Beams Down to Logo’s New Now Next Awards
Estonian pop singer/songwriter Kerli looked like she was transported from a distant glamorous planet in her rainbow-colored hair and out-of-this-world outfit to attend Logo TV’s NewNowNext Awards, the network’s annual celebration of all things hot and fresh in music and pop culture.
Kerli famously accused Lady Gaga of copying everything she does. She also wrote Demi Lovato‘s emotional anthem “Skyscraper.”.

Kerli Starstruck After Meeting Richard Branson
Celebuzz caught up with Kerli at the NewNowNext Awards on Thursday night, which air Monday (April 9) at 10p/9c on Logo. The Estonian pop singer talked about how she decides what to wear to an event, being starstruck by Richard Branson after meeting the billionaire business magnate at a pre Grammy party, and wanting more views after her ‘Zero Gravity’ video crossed the million mark.
“I’m not really the pop culture celebrity kind of.. I don’t buy the magazines, I don’t have a TV,” she said about the Branson encounter. “I’m not really inspired by fame necessarily, but when I met Richard Branson, for me he’s one of the biggest thinkers of our time, so that was very, very impressive. I was really wanting to cry and was shaking and I was like, ‘I cannot believe I’m meeting Richard Branson.’”
